Mother pleads not guilty in taped fight
URBANA -- A Champaign mother has pleaded not guilty to urging her 15-year-old daughter to fight another girl in a confrontation later posted on YouTube.
Dawn Morris was charged Friday in an Urbana court with one count of contributing to the criminal delinquency of a juvenile. The 37-year-old woman is jailed on $50,000 bond. Her next court date is May 26.
Police arrested Morris Thursday after school officials called them about the video of the fight.
Police say a tape of the fight recorded by someone using a cell phone camera allegedly showed Morris urging her daughter to fight another 15-year-old in a park near their high school.
Champaign County State's Attorney Julia Rietz says the girls are each charged with one count of aggravated battery.
